Power off the iPhone
Remove the charging cable and any accessories
Inspect the charging port with a flashlight
Use a dry, soft, anti-static brush to gently loosen debris
Use a clean, dry, wooden or plastic toothpick to carefully remove lint
Hold the phone with the port facing downward while cleaning
Tap the phone lightly to dislodge loose debris
Blow short bursts of air from a can of compressed air if needed
Avoid using metal objects
Avoid using liquids, sprays, or cleaning solutions
Avoid inserting anything too deep into the port
Recheck the port for remaining debris
Test charging with a cable after cleaning
Seek professional repair if the port is damaged or still not charging
